Transaction 28c045ea4d37f6be86ac5080694247a276a182d3c55ef74e4012014c5b8d9be0
1 Input
2 Outputs
- 28c045ea4d37f6be86ac5080694247a276a182d3c55ef74e4012014c5b8d9be0:0
- 28c045ea4d37f6be86ac5080694247a276a182d3c55ef74e4012014c5b8d9be0:1
value 31343250
address 1P3c59eugGpR4fKvnopkATxGx7LTuxTx9z
value 636410
address 1CWMJwvi8FXYyytMekppQPZjfFSGk5zvMM